Title: The Innovations and Contributions of Inventor Heinz-Juergen Voelkel
Introduction: Heinz-Juergen Voelkel, a notable inventor based in Langenfeld, Germany, has made significant strides in the field of bleaching agent technology. With two patents to his name, Voelkel's work focuses on enhancing the efficiency and stability of bleaching agents in various cleaning applications.
Latest Patents: Voelkel's latest patents include a groundbreaking method for the production of particulate bleaching agent compositions. This innovative process involves granulating a particulate peroxide compound and a water-soluble polymer, which can be ionotropically cross-linked, into a primary granulate using a liquid binding agent containing water. This primary granulate is then treated with a cross-linking agent, resulting in a particle that can be incorporated into liquid detergents and cleaning agents while maintaining stability.
Another significant contribution from Voelkel is the development of encapsulated bleaching agent particles. This innovative approach allows for the creation of a shelf-stable liquid agent or detergent containing a bleaching agent encapsulated in a crosslinkable polymer matrix. These advancements are vital in enhancing the performance and longevity of cleaning products.
